Understanding the Core Principles of Sweetyspin Construction
At its heart, sweetyspin is about manipulating the air within the fiber structure. Unlike traditional spinning which focuses on tightly twisting fibers together for strength and uniformity, sweetyspin embraces a more open and delicate architecture. The process often involves lightly twisting or loosely locking fibers together, then introducing air into the yarnâs core. This air incorporation is often achieved through specialized machinery or carefully controlled hand-spinning techniques. The aim isnât necessarily to create a strong, durable yarn in the traditional sense, but rather one that prioritizes volume, softness, and a unique tactile experience. Different fiber types respond differently to the sweetyspin process; finer fibers like merino or silk tend to create a particularly airy and delicate result, while coarser fibers can offer a more substantial, yet still voluminous, texture.
Fiber Choices and Their Impact on Sweetyspin Yarns
The selection of fiber plays a crucial role in determining the final characteristics of a sweetyspin yarn. Natural fibers like wool, alpaca, cashmere, and cotton are commonly used due to their inherent softness and ability to trap air. Synthetic fibers, such as acrylic or nylon, can also be incorporated to add durability or specific textural qualities. The length and crimp of the fibers also influence the outcome; longer, crimpier fibers tend to create more loft and airiness. Blending different fiber types allows artisans to customize the yarnâs properties, achieving unique combinations of softness, drape, and warmth. For example, a blend of merino wool and silk might result in a luxuriously soft and shimmering sweetyspin yarn, while a blend of alpaca and nylon could offer a more durable and resilient option.
| Fiber Type | Characteristics in Sweetyspin |
|---|---|
| Merino Wool | Exceptional softness, high loft, delicate airiness |
| Alpaca | Warmth, drape, a slightly more substantial volume |
| Silk | Shimmer, luxurious feel, delicate structure |
| Cotton | Breathability, softness, a more relaxed drape |
Experimentation with different fiber combinations is key to unlocking the full potential of sweetyspin. Understanding how each fiber responds to the process allows artisans to create yarns with a wide range of textures and properties, catering to diverse project requirements.
Applications of Sweetyspin in Knitting and Crochet
The unique characteristics of sweetyspin yarns make them particularly well-suited for certain types of knitting and crochet projects. Due to their airy nature, sweetyspin yarns create fabrics with a beautiful drape and a soft, cloud-like texture. This makes them ideal for garments like shawls, wraps, and sweaters designed for comfort and style. The voluminous nature of the yarn also means that projects tend to knit up quickly, making it a satisfying choice for those seeking a faster turnaround time. However, itâs important to note that sweetyspin yarns typically have a lower stitch definition compared to traditionally spun yarns. Therefore, they may not be the best choice for projects requiring intricate patterns or sharp details. Instead, they excel in designs that emphasize texture, drape, and a relaxed aesthetic.
Designing with Sweetyspin: Considerations for Pattern Selection
When designing or selecting patterns to use with sweetyspin yarns, several factors should be considered. Simpler stitch patterns, such as garter stitch or stockinette stitch, tend to showcase the yarnâs texture and drape most effectively. Cables and textured stitches can also work well, but may require adjustments to account for the yarnâs looser structure. Itâs often beneficial to use larger needles or crochet hooks than typically recommended for the yarn weight, as this allows the yarn to bloom and fully express its volume. Gauge swatches are particularly important when working with sweetyspin yarns, as the airy nature can lead to variations in stitch size. Careful blocking is also essential to ensure that the finished fabric drapes beautifully and maintains its shape.
